royontechnology.blogspot.com royontechnology.blogspot.com

royontechnology.blogspot.com

Roy's musings

On Java and other bits. Wednesday, March 11, 2015. Bit twiddling in JDK to generate random number. Some time back a friend asked me an algorithm question:. Given an integer random number generator randomN() that can generate random number in the range [0, N), how will you generate random numbers in the range [0, M) where M. It is easy to visualize this. See the diagram below:. So how do we generate uniform random numbers? MaxAllowed = N - (N mod M). While (randValue = maxAllowed). Return maxAllowed mod M.

http://royontechnology.blogspot.com/

WEBSITE DETAILS
SEO
PAGES
SIMILAR SITES

TRAFFIC RANK FOR ROYONTECHNOLOGY.BLOGSPOT.COM

TODAY'S RATING

>1,000,000

TRAFFIC RANK - AVERAGE PER MONTH

BEST MONTH

September

AVERAGE PER DAY Of THE WEEK

HIGHEST TRAFFIC ON

Saturday

TRAFFIC BY CITY

CUSTOMER REVIEWS

Average Rating: 3.6 out of 5 with 13 reviews
5 star
5
4 star
2
3 star
4
2 star
0
1 star
2

Hey there! Start your review of royontechnology.blogspot.com

AVERAGE USER RATING

Write a Review

WEBSITE PREVIEW

Desktop Preview Tablet Preview Mobile Preview

LOAD TIME

0.4 seconds

FAVICON PREVIEW

  • royontechnology.blogspot.com

    16x16

  • royontechnology.blogspot.com

    32x32

  • royontechnology.blogspot.com

    64x64

  • royontechnology.blogspot.com

    128x128

CONTACTS AT ROYONTECHNOLOGY.BLOGSPOT.COM

Login

TO VIEW CONTACTS

Remove Contacts

FOR PRIVACY ISSUES

CONTENT

SCORE

6.2

PAGE TITLE
Roy's musings | royontechnology.blogspot.com Reviews
<META>
DESCRIPTION
On Java and other bits. Wednesday, March 11, 2015. Bit twiddling in JDK to generate random number. Some time back a friend asked me an algorithm question:. Given an integer random number generator randomN() that can generate random number in the range [0, N), how will you generate random numbers in the range [0, M) where M. It is easy to visualize this. See the diagram below:. So how do we generate uniform random numbers? MaxAllowed = N - (N mod M). While (randValue = maxAllowed). Return maxAllowed mod M.
<META>
KEYWORDS
1 roy's musings
2 do {
3 randvalue = randomn
4 posted by
5 no comments
6 labels algorithms
7 java
8 is accepting optional
9 as arguments
10 labels best practices
CONTENT
Page content here
KEYWORDS ON
PAGE
roy's musings,do {,randvalue = randomn,posted by,no comments,labels algorithms,java,is accepting optional,as arguments,labels best practices,java 8,labels logback,scala,labels eclipse,intellij idea,labels hibernate,lastpass,hope that helps,labels infosec
SERVER
GSE
CONTENT-TYPE
utf-8
GOOGLE PREVIEW

Roy's musings | royontechnology.blogspot.com Reviews

https://royontechnology.blogspot.com

On Java and other bits. Wednesday, March 11, 2015. Bit twiddling in JDK to generate random number. Some time back a friend asked me an algorithm question:. Given an integer random number generator randomN() that can generate random number in the range [0, N), how will you generate random numbers in the range [0, M) where M. It is easy to visualize this. See the diagram below:. So how do we generate uniform random numbers? MaxAllowed = N - (N mod M). While (randValue = maxAllowed). Return maxAllowed mod M.

INTERNAL PAGES

royontechnology.blogspot.com royontechnology.blogspot.com
1

Roy's musings: 04/01/2013 - 05/01/2013

http://royontechnology.blogspot.com/2013_04_01_archive.html

On Java and other bits. Tuesday, April 23, 2013. This is an interesting problem that I ran into. The problem definition goes like this. You are given an array of integers. The array is considerably large (say 5 million elements). You are given two inputs: an index i. In the array and an integer value v. Start searching the array for value v. From the index i. And expand your search towards the two edges of the array. Return the index where the value v. Occurs closest to index i. If the value v.

2

Roy's musings: Bit twiddling in JDK to generate random number

http://royontechnology.blogspot.com/2015/03/bit-twiddling-in-jdk-to-generate-random.html

On Java and other bits. Wednesday, March 11, 2015. Bit twiddling in JDK to generate random number. Some time back a friend asked me an algorithm question:. Given an integer random number generator randomN() that can generate random number in the range [0, N), how will you generate random numbers in the range [0, M) where M. It is easy to visualize this. See the diagram below:. So how do we generate uniform random numbers? MaxAllowed = N - (N mod M). While (randValue = maxAllowed). Return maxAllowed mod M.

3

Roy's musings: 04/01/2014 - 05/01/2014

http://royontechnology.blogspot.com/2014_04_01_archive.html

On Java and other bits. Tuesday, April 08, 2014. Heartbleed bug in OpenSSL. There was a serious vulnerability. Reported in the OpenSSL library that can let the attacker to dump memory contents from the server. Thus the attacker can perform offline analysis of the memory contents and identify sensitive information like private key of the server, key material for SSL sessions, decrypted data that is in memory, etc. This affects any server that uses OpenSSL to implement HTTPS. Or you can use this site.

4

Roy's musings: The most important keyboard shortcut you should know in IntelliJ IDEA

http://royontechnology.blogspot.com/2014/07/the-most-important-keyboard-shortcut.html

On Java and other bits. Monday, July 21, 2014. The most important keyboard shortcut you should know in IntelliJ IDEA. TLDR; If you are new to IntelliJ (like me), use "Cmd Shift A". To find your way around. Based on my research, I felt that IntelliJ IDEA has better support for Scala. So I wanted to give it a spin. So far I feel so good that I decided to give it a try. For Emacs users, this is very similar to "apropos" command. For Eclipse users, this is similar to "Cmd Shift L", but only better. I am Roy&...

5

Roy's musings: 07/01/2013 - 08/01/2013

http://royontechnology.blogspot.com/2013_07_01_archive.html

On Java and other bits. Monday, July 15, 2013. A Python script to execute Python code like "perl -ne". I wrote a small utility script that can be used to run a small snippet of Python code like "perl -ne". I find it very useful for my needs. Hope it helps you too. Any suggestions welcome. You can find the script as a gist here. Setting the terminal window title - version 2. If [ -z "$ORIG PS1" ] ; then. Export PS1=" [ 033]0;$1 - u@ h: w 007 ]$ORIG PS1". Wednesday, July 03, 2013. I came across this gem: -h.

UPGRADE TO PREMIUM TO VIEW 14 MORE

TOTAL PAGES IN THIS WEBSITE

19

LINKS TO THIS WEBSITE

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: February 2010

http://veenagopu.blogspot.com/2010_02_01_archive.html

Tuesday, February 2, 2010. This site goes a long way in helping recycle things. So? Make use of it. Subscribe to: Posts (Atom). Help a hungry kid! A woman who has traveled half the way around the world to be with her husband :-) and one who misses home in India! View my complete profile.

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: Weekend Sleeping | ‌விடுமுறை நா‌ள் தூ‌க்க‌ம் ந‌ல்லதுதா‌ன்

http://veenagopu.blogspot.com/2010/01/weekend-sleeping.html

Friday, January 29, 2010. Weekend Sleeping ‌விடுமுறை நா‌ள் தூ‌க்க‌ம் ந‌ல்லதுதா‌ன். Weekend Sleeping ‌விடுமுறை நா‌ள் தூ‌க்க‌ம் ந‌ல்லதுதா‌ன். Subscribe to: Post Comments (Atom). Help a hungry kid! Weekend Sleeping ‌விடுமுறை நா‌ள் தூ‌க்க‌ம் ந‌ல்ல. Your Mobile Giving by State. A woman who has traveled half the way around the world to be with her husband :-) and one who misses home in India! View my complete profile.

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: Pollution eating plants

http://veenagopu.blogspot.com/2010/01/pollution-eating-plants.html

Wednesday, January 20, 2010. Http:/ www.ecoartisan.org/pollution.html. Http:/ www.wolvertonenvironmental.com/airFAQ.htm. Http:/ www.brighthub.com/environment/science-environmental/articles/37020.aspx. Http:/ www.ars.usda.gov/is/AR/archive/jun00/soil0600.htm. Hope this will inspire me to buy some indoor plants sooner :-). Subscribe to: Post Comments (Atom). Help a hungry kid! Your Mobile Giving by State. View my complete profile.

arivuppasi.blogspot.com arivuppasi.blogspot.com

Arivuppasi: April 2007

http://arivuppasi.blogspot.com/2007_04_01_archive.html

Sunday, April 29, 2007. Off late, I started watching a few of Alfred Hichcock's movies. I would say "Dial M For Murder" is the best detective movie I have ever seen. I have started liking the subtleness of the characters and the succinct dialogs. Especially when Inspector Hubbard asks Margot, "Madam, you are saying that you didn't see the killer. But you confirm that you don't know the killer. How is that so? Pardon me for not being verbatim :-). These are the list of movies I have watched so far:.

arivuppasi.blogspot.com arivuppasi.blogspot.com

Arivuppasi: November 2006

http://arivuppasi.blogspot.com/2006_11_01_archive.html

Tuesday, November 14, 2006. The fiasco of seeking suggestions. I sought suggestions to my friends to buy a camcorder through the group mail. No one responded, and mean no one did. It is something that I can contribute by writing a camera/camcorder buyer's guide myself, as I consider myself to be "knowledgeable enough" now to buy one for me. I spent a few days reading things out and understanding different parameters that come into play. A lot of gotchas! Posted by Roy at 4:27 AM. Links to this post.

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: Earth911

http://veenagopu.blogspot.com/2010/02/earth911.html

Tuesday, February 2, 2010. This site goes a long way in helping recycle things. So? Make use of it. February 5, 2010 at 6:09 PM. Subscribe to: Post Comments (Atom). Help a hungry kid! A woman who has traveled half the way around the world to be with her husband :-) and one who misses home in India! View my complete profile.

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: June 2010

http://veenagopu.blogspot.com/2010_06_01_archive.html

Thursday, June 17, 2010. Monday, June 7, 2010. Have you ever heard of people playing pranks on themselves. Well it was our turn y'day. Srini and Shyamini, our buddies, came over for dinner to our place y'day. These guys had to pick up their cousin from airport at 9.55pm. After the dinner, Srini developed a severe headache. (Yeah! We didn't have time to ponder over it anyway. Our Jolly fellow offered to drive and we quickly started our drive to SFO. This was bulb no:1. There is more to come.

veenagopu.blogspot.com veenagopu.blogspot.com

My Musings: Juicer

http://veenagopu.blogspot.com/2010/06/juicer.html

Thursday, June 17, 2010. Subscribe to: Post Comments (Atom). Help a hungry kid! A woman who has traveled half the way around the world to be with her husband :-) and one who misses home in India! View my complete profile.

arivuppasi.blogspot.com arivuppasi.blogspot.com

Arivuppasi: May 2007

http://arivuppasi.blogspot.com/2007_05_01_archive.html

Thursday, May 10, 2007. 12 Angry Men" and "Anatomy Of A Murder". Recently I happened to see both " 12 Angry Men. 1957) and " Anatomy Of A Murder. 1959) I simply loved "12 Angry Men" more than any other court trial movie I have ever seen. The entire movie is taken in a jury room, not set in the exact court room. None of the characters' names are introduced till the end of the movie. The kind of questions that Henry Fonda raises, simply amazing. Posted by Roy at 10:41 PM. Links to this post.

arivuppasi.blogspot.com arivuppasi.blogspot.com

Arivuppasi: New blog started for technology

http://arivuppasi.blogspot.com/2006/10/new-blog-started-for-technology.html

Wednesday, October 25, 2006. New blog started for technology. It made sense to separate the personal expressions from what I want to speak about technology. The result is this blog. Hence I would be posting only non-technical issues in this blog, and urge you to follow the other blog for technology related musings. Posted by Roy at 6:29 AM. Buy Cialis, Viagra, Levitra, Tamiflu. Order Generic Medication In own Pharmacy. Buy Pills Central. At Thu Nov 12, 04:33:00 PM. At Tue Nov 17, 05:07:00 AM.

UPGRADE TO PREMIUM TO VIEW 16 MORE

TOTAL LINKS TO THIS WEBSITE

26

OTHER SITES

royonline.org royonline.org

Roy Family Home Page

royonmaui.com royonmaui.com

Your Window into Maui Real Estate | When Results Matter

Search for Homes in. Your Window into Maui Real Estate. Search for Homes in. Learn more about Your. Learn more about Maui. Find a home in. Find out how much you can afford. Residential / Single Family. Welcome to ZillowPress Sites. This is your first post. Edit or delete it, then start blogging! Continue Reading →. Your browser doesn't support frames. Visit Zillow Mortgage Marketplace. To see this content. Coldwell Banker Island Properties. 500,000 - 4 Sunny St. 535,000 - 5 Sunny St. 535,003 - 6 Sunny St.

royonphotography.com royonphotography.com

Roy’s Beginning Photography Tips

Things You Should Have. Setting Up Your Camera: Buttons and Menus. My Top Tips to Better Photos. Sharing and Creating with Your Photos. Backing Up Your Photos. Touching Up Your Photos. Types of Digital Cameras to Own. Click HERE to check out a few web pages on photography that I like to frequent.

royonrescue.com royonrescue.com

Emergency Rescue Video Blog, CPR Training, and Emergency Rescue Topics covered by Roy Shaw from ProCPR at Roy on Rescue

Bull; Patient Assessment. RoyOnRescue Interviews Lifeguard Who Rescued Poolside Patient. June 27, 2015. Three cheers for our heroic Lifeguards! In this episode, I get the opportunity to speak with Logan Evans, the Life Guard who was part of a three person team of First Aid providers who helped a woman who had apparently had a seizure and fallen in the Women’s shower room at a local pool! Bull; Life Saved. Bull; on scene interview. Bull; Roy Shaw. Bull; Roy W. Shaw. Bull; summer emergency. June 3, 2015.

royonrescue.tumblr.com royonrescue.tumblr.com

Roy On Rescue

RoyOnRescue Interviews Lifeguard Who Rescued Poolside Patient. Three cheers for our heroic Lifeguards! In this episode, I get the opportunity to speak with Logan Evans, the Life Guard who was part of a three person team of First Aid providers who helped a woman who had apparently had a seizure and fallen in the Women’s shower room at a local pool! Posted 1 month ago. How To Remove A Tick and Prevent Lyme Disease! Posted 2 months ago. How to remove a tick. What do I do. Posted 3 months ago. No one to help.

royontechnology.blogspot.com royontechnology.blogspot.com

Roy's musings

On Java and other bits. Wednesday, March 11, 2015. Bit twiddling in JDK to generate random number. Some time back a friend asked me an algorithm question:. Given an integer random number generator randomN() that can generate random number in the range [0, N), how will you generate random numbers in the range [0, M) where M. It is easy to visualize this. See the diagram below:. So how do we generate uniform random numbers? MaxAllowed = N - (N mod M). While (randValue = maxAllowed). Return maxAllowed mod M.

royontheradio.blogspot.com royontheradio.blogspot.com

Roy on the Radio

Roy on the Radio. Friday, December 08, 2006. TRANSCRIPT: Roy Williams Radio Show, December 7, 2006. TRANSCRIPT: Roy Williams Radio Show, December 7, 2006. WOODY: Welcome once again to the Roy Williams Radio Show, brought to you as always by Beefmaster. Beefmaster: Master your beef. And Beefmaster's new "Healthy Bites" - a tasty new bite sized soy protein snack that tastes just like real beef. Try a Beefmaster healthy bite today. Welcome coach. ROY: Nice to be with you, Woody. ROY: Yes, you do. WOODY: Now...

royontherun.blogspot.com royontherun.blogspot.com

Roy on the Run

Tuesday, 14 July 2015. Thanks to Natalia and Gerardo for organizing and to Tommy for the awesome pics! Waveforms - Django Django). Monday, 6 July 2015. Swim Until You Can't See Land. Cheung Sha Beach, Lantau. Swim Until You Can't See Land - Frightened Rabbit). Friday, 3 July 2015. Day Off, Kennedy Town. Dragon Win, Stanley Beach. Boyfriend, Somewhere taking Selfies. Garbanzo Soup in 35. Work with The Spiller, BEP. Dragon Boating, Mui Wo. Mess Is Mine - Vance Joy). Subscribe to: Posts (Atom).

royontheweb.com royontheweb.com

HUNTER MINSTREL’S WORLD

I have lived on Lake Windermere for the last 3 years after living on Derwent Water for the previous 12 years, so for the last 15 years at least, no salt water. I get visited by quite a lot of gulls, but my owner keeps me clean and regularly comes aboard for a wash and brush up. A snippet of my life. Minstrel 23 relaxing, Waterhead, Windermere.

royonwheels.com royonwheels.com

Index of /